WDM NextGen offers<br />

future stars a podium<br />

In 2010 WDM initiated the WDM Youth Challenge, the predecessor<br />

of WDM NextGen, together with the Jiva Hill Resort owned by the<br />

Lundin Family. Staging an U25 class with a tailored sports format at<br />

a selection of WDM shows gave young Grand Prix riders a chance to<br />

compete under perfect conditions. At shows where the top seniors<br />

compete the future stars of our sport needed a podium.<br />

In 2015 NextGen became part of<br />

the <strong>Dressage</strong>4Good Foundation<br />

which was initiated by <strong>World</strong> <strong>Dressage</strong><br />

<strong>Masters</strong> (WDM) together with several<br />

dressage stakeholders and dressage<br />

families. One of WDM´s missions is to<br />

develop new stars. Not an easy mission<br />

but we like to believe that over the last<br />

8 years WDM has become synonymous<br />

for positive and open innovation.<br />

To build a strong foundation under<br />

the future of dressage WDM started<br />

the <strong>Dressage</strong>4Good Foundation that<br />

works on numerous not for profit<br />

projects like youth development,<br />

research, knowledge transfer and<br />

internationalisation.<br />

Through the years several NextGen<br />

participants successfully made the<br />

switch to the seniors. Good examples<br />

are Danielle Heijkoop, Jessica von<br />

Bredow-Werndl and Jorinde Verwimp<br />

who competed in the NextGen classes<br />

and had the chance to gain experience<br />

at a 5* setting to prepare themselves for<br />

the Big Tour.<br />

Because riders loved it and the first<br />

results were there, WDM has decided<br />

to create a fast lane for talented young<br />

dressage riders within the WDM sports<br />

framework by gradually adding junior<br />

and young rider classes to the program.<br />

This is why the WDM Youth Challenge<br />

was rebranded to WDM NextGen.<br />
